Hello!! I hereby present you, no more, no less, than Kermageddon A real BOOM in your world size Minds behind Kermageddon: 1337patchy & NoobLevler Code Language: C#.NET IDE used: Visual Studio C# Express 2010 Requirements: A PC (running Windows) capable of running KSP & An updated version of .net framework For Mac users (unnoficial support, Tutorial by darkwolfpaw54): "FOR ALL MAC USERS THAT WANT TO USE THIS ADDON you will need:bootcamp windows 7 and famework err whatever. FIRST STEP use bootcamp to make windows 7 working then net.framework installed and bootcamped for mac platforms.STEP TWO run kermageddon and set the ports up and wala it works like if its on a pc." Q: What is Kermageddon? R: Kermageddon is an application which allows you and your friends to play in the same world, see each other's ships in orbit, as if your world were a Multiplayer world. Q: So...That means its a Real Time Multiplayer? R: Of Course ...not!! UnfortunatelyQ: How does it synch vessels then? R: Well, first of all, the session must be hosted in a FTP server. But do not worry, that does not mean it is hard to use, because it is not. Only the FTP host needs to know how to set up a FTP server, the other players only need the server ip, and login credentials, which are given by the host! So, when you start your game through Kermageddon, it downloads a file from the server's root, and merges your savefile with it, bringing other people's ships and orbits to your game, populating your nice world with them! When you close your game, Kermageddon detects that, and prepares a file to upload to the server, with your ships, and the ones on the server All that, just by pressing a button! It's super simple!!Q: What if someone saved a vessel that uses parts from a mod i do not have? You will get a little window, ingame, telling you a certain ship could not be loaded! Q: Will support and updates be provided? R: Support? Most certainly Updates? Maybe depends on the general interest on Kermageddon and it being updated Q: What do I need on my FTP server to be able to host a session? R: Well, you need to create a copy of the savefile you want to start with, with or without vessels, and place it on the server's root. Rename the savefile to persistent2.sfs !! Those last two steps are VERY Important, place the file on the server's root, and rename it to persistent2.sfs !! !! !! If you do not know where to find your savefile, on the computer, navigate to your Kerbal Space Program's root folder, and click a folder called "saves". Inside it should be a folder called "default". Persistent.sfs should be inside "default" folder (Read this first, it may save you the work of asking! ) Known Bugs and Fixes/Work-a-Rounds: Bug (clientside??): Missing Part Dialog, due to not having a certain addon someone else has, will not show completely, rendering it impossible to close, disturbing the game. --/--/ Workaround: Launching a spaceship, and crashing it in the ground imediatelly after takeoff. After that, press the scenery if the end flight dialog does not show. From the dialog click "Space Center", and it should now be possible to close the Missing part dialog! If not, try to repeat!! Project folder (source code included) (Not required to run Kermageddon) http://www./?lrq677dwdaj9lb9 Kermageddon Download http://www./?opodg7ky2o96bhl -----------------------------------------------------/--------------------------------------------/------------------------------------------------- Changelog: 08 September 2012 23:18 GMT+01: Added new Kermageddon download link, .zip packed with readme for client and host. -----------------------------------------------------/--------------------------------------------/------------------------------------------------- We WILL pay close attention to this thread, investigate the bugs found, try to reproduce them and find a possible Work-a-Round, we will also consider your ideas to make Kermageddon better in future versions. Notice, future and updated versions will only be created if there is interest on them, and enough time . Do not forget, this is a Community Feedback Alpha version, so we are counting on your feedback to spot problems and bugs! First, you will need someone to host the FTP server for you. The host will give you the server ip, the username, and password! You will insert them into the appropriate fields. Then you can select KSP's root folder on the folder selector. After that, decide if you want a backup, by clicking the checkbox :-) Then just Press START, and Kermageddon will do EVERYTHING for you!! Notice: If Kermageddon crashes, or if there is a connection problem with the server, your save file will not be merged and uploaded to the server, if the first scenario occurs, and will most likely not get merged, and uploaded, if the second scenario occurs. If you want to host, you will need to create a FTP Server! That is pretty easy for people with some knowledge on the field. If you have no idea on how to setup a FTP server, you can search around on the internet for a tutorial on how to setup a FTP server. I have found this tutorial, i did not test it though, but it should work. http://www.raymond.cc/blog/how-to-setup-ftp-server-on-windows/ After having the FTP Server ready, copy your KSP save file, called persistent.sfs, which can be found by going to KSP's root folder\saves\default, and paste the persistent.sfs on the root of the FTP (main folder of the FTP). Rename persistent.sfs to persistent2.sfs (the one on the FTP root folder of course ) If you want to start a new save on your Multiplayer world, with no ships, delete all the Vessels from persistent2.sfs ! Then thats done, just turn on the server, and give whoever you want your IP and server username (if IP is, for example, x.xx.xxx.xx, on the FTP adress on kermageddon you write ftp://x.xx.xxx.xx). If your server is password protected, you will need to give the password too! That's it! Hope this brief explanation helps guys! Before posting about Kessler and saying this idea was stolen, or something identical already existed, read post #4 at http://kerbalspaceprogram.com/forum/showthread.php/19400-WIP-Kermageddon Email the authors: 1337patchy
[email protected] NoobLevler
[email protected] <a rel="license" href="http://creativecommons.org/licenses/by-nc-sa/3.0/"><img alt="Creative Commons License" style="border-width:0" src="http://i.creativecommons.org/l/by-nc-sa/3.0/88x31.png" /></a><br />This work is licensed under a <a rel="license" href="http://creativecommons.org/licenses/by-nc-sa/3.0/">Creative Commons Attribution-NonCommercial-ShareAlike 3.0 Unported License</a>.